The Fallout Franchise: A Brief Overview
Before discussing the potential for a second season, it’s essential to understand what Fallout represents. The franchise originated in 1997 with the release of the first Fallout game, developed by Interplay Entertainment. Set in a retro-futuristic, post-apocalyptic world ravaged by nuclear war, the games have consistently explored themes of survival, morality, and the consequences of human actions. With a rich lore that encompasses multiple games, novels, and spin-offs, Fallout has amassed a dedicated fan base.

The Success of Season 1
As of October 2024, Fallout has premiered its first season, which consists of eight episodes. The response from both critics and audiences has been largely positive. Critics praised the show for its faithful representation of the source material, engaging performances, and the clever blending of humor and horror that the franchise is known for. The production design and world-building were also highlighted, creating a visually captivating post-apocalyptic landscape that resonates with fans of the games.
